Finalmente



Example: Finalmente abbiamo trovato una soluzione al problema complesso.

Definition


"Finalmente" is an adverb used to indicate that something has happened at last or after a long wait, often expressing relief or satisfaction. For example, in 'Finalmente abbiamo trovato una soluzione al problema complesso,' it means 'At last, we found a solution to the complex problem.'

Etymology


The word "finalmente" comes from the Italian adjective 'finale,' meaning 'final,' combined with the adverbial suffix '-mente,' which turns adjectives into adverbs. It literally conveys the idea of something happening in a final or concluding manner. Did you know that the suffix '-mente' is related to the Latin word 'mente,' meaning 'mind,' originally implying 'with a [certain] mind or manner'?
